Nika Posted May 23, 2001 Share Posted May 23, 2001 Brent, While we appreciate your zeal at distributing information, correct information would be more useful. Alesis is up for auction tomorrow. Numark currently has funded the bankruptcy of Alesis, but anyone can bid for Alesis tomorrow and walk away with the company. Part of the contingency, however, is that they have to pay Numark back what they have invested in the Bankruptcy filing. There are several companies that are rumored to have been eyeing Alesis, and these names stretch from ones like Roland to Digidesign and about everyone in between. Further, as with any situation like this, there are likely some vultures on the side that are sitting back anxiously awaiting to pounce at the first opportunity to pick up a "brand" either to sell of later or otherwise. At this point Numark has expressed the strongest interest in Alesis, but it is by no means to say that the deal is done. The auction has not happened. I am writing this to stop the spread of misinformation on these forums. I hope that this has been helpful. Thanx! Nika. For more...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Max Ventura Posted May 24, 2001 Share Posted May 24, 2001 I have a deeper respect for Alesis than I have for most (or all) of the other major manufacturers. The high-standard of quality they have always showed us, plus the ease of use generally associated with their product, and now the turn of direction with bold new designs, amazing new concepts and products, still coming with a reasonable price tag, always made me happy. In fact, I have several Alesis stuff in my studio and I think I'll take more. Numark is NOT a cheesy company, for all I'm concerned. I sell DJ equipment so please allow me to know my trade. Numark was the first company to introduce modern, breakthru equipment in the DJ world, immediately followed by Gemini (which IS much cheesier) and Vestax (which is much more expensive). Numark products deliver. Their DM-series DJ mixers have a frightening EQ that totally collapses the signal under the audible, if wanted. I haven't found that feature in any other mixer so far. They have been first in bold designs with the Kaoss Pad /mixer hybrid, even before Korg itself, which is the very maker of Kaoss Pad. But, besides mixers, CD and turntables, they don't actually make much more, they stick to their trade, and I haven't noticed any rapacious attitude until today, so as long as they leave Alesis be Alesis and continue being Numark, all is well and we're all happy.
